KOCK 2004

 

On Sunday, 18th December, at 7 a.m. we gathered together with a group of young people from Lublin and neighbouring towns in order to set off for a Christmas evangelistic concert in Międzyrzec Podlaski. We needed 4 cars for about 20 people, some of whom – despite a sleepless night – came punctually, ready for the trip. However, in Międzyrzec we had an unpleased surprise. Although the concert, after which we were going to distribute Christmas parcels for children, was planned a long time ago, there were some problems. Near the cinema we had rented for that purpose they had works in the ground which caused the electricity to be cut off. We were forced to cancel the concert but we didn’t want to give up organising evangelism that day. Since it was too late to find a vacant hall in other town we decided to stop in Kock, which lies between Międzyrzec and Lublin. We put the equipment in a main square and we were able to present a short version of the program. God blessed us. We gathered many people around us. Many of them stayed until the end of our concert, which consisted of Christmas carols, worship songs, pantomimes, dance and short testimonies. Ronald Gabrielsen a missionary from Denmark was preaching and his wife Katarzynyna Gabrielsen was translating in to Polish. At the end we gave people new Testaments, books for children and evangelistic leaflets. We had very interesting conversations with many people, mostly young. We were also praying together with a young girl who was moved by our performance. Other nice situation was that we were given electricity from on of the nearby shops. We thank God for the possibility of preaching the Gospel in this town and we believe that it was the answer for our prayers. We were praying for Kock every time we were driving through it. We believe that in the future we will organise bigger concert there.
